I am currently enrolled in an employer sponsored Roth 401k plan. I have only been enrolled in the plan for a few months but will soon be taking a job with a new employer that does not offer any type of Roth plan. Is it possible to Rollover the Roth 401k from my old employer to a Roth IRA, even though I have not met the 5 year rule? Thanks for your help in advance.

Posted

yes, but the '5 year clock' starts ticking again (unless you had establshed a ROTH IRA as well)

for anyone else out there reading this, this is an interesting recomendation implied by the regulations:

at the time someone starts a Roth 401(k) they should also establish a Roth IRA!!!!!!

see page 13/14 (assuming this shows the same format on your computer as mine, my print out from months ago is page 17) of the preamble to the regs
